What is the primary purpose of the Kyoto Protocol?

to decrease the dependence on natural resources in developing countries
to limit and decrease the worldwide emission of greenhouse gases
to encourage the growth of a global economy by creating a single world currency
to shed light on human rights abuses in countries torn by political unrest
to study the various indicators of democracy in different countries
